WC Platinum Chef Challenge

Welcome to my first blogging event, the WC Platinum Chef Challenge! This idea was born on the What’s Cooking message board on thenest.com, and I hope many of my fellow nestie chefs will participate, as well as anyone else who would like to take part. Here is how it will work:

*Current host will choose 5 ingredients for the challenge
*Participants must create a meal using those ingredients
*The meal can consist of 1 or 2 dishes – so you can use all the ingredients in one recipe, or make two. Ex. main dish + side, appetizer + main dish, main dish + dessert, etc. But, if more than one dish is created, each dish must use at least two of the ingredients (and, any ingredient may be repeated and used in both dishes if desired).
*You can add whatever other ingredients you like
*The event will run for two weeks at a time
*When you’ve decided upon and prepared your dishes, please post pictures and recipes in your blog, link to this post, and send me an email at platinumchefchallenge@gmail.com. (if you don’t have a blog, please send pictures and recipes anyway!)

Here are your Challenge Ingredients:

Basil

Strawberries

Nuts (any kind you choose!)

Tomatoes (fresh, canned, dried, grape, plum, green, whatever!)

Zucchini
